MK-1045 Trial for R/R B-ALL Compares to Blinatumomab
A clinical trial is underway to evaluate MK-1045 against blinatumomab in patients with relapsed or refractory B-c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ia.

Strategic implication
The outcome of this trial could influence the competitive positioning of MK-1045 against blinatumomab, affecting market access strategies and potential pricing models for both therapies. Positive results may lead to prioritization of MK-1045 in the pipeline and impact licensing discussions.
Why it matters
The ongoing clinical trial comparing MK-1045 to blinatumomab in patients with relapsed or refractory B-c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ia is significant for stakeholders in oncology. The results will provide critical data on the efficacy and safety of MK-1045, potentially altering treatment protocols and influencing market dynamics.
